[Touch-packages] [Bug 2063040] [NEW] network-manager 1.46.0-1ubuntu2 on noble causes IPv4 address removal when no DHCP server is present

2024-04-21 Thread Andreas Karlson
Public bug reported: I tried using a noble VM using a "host-only" network connection (which does not have a DHCP server). After adding an IPv4 address manually (using the ip command), NetworkManager retries activating the network connection, which removes the address that was previously added.
